Como encontrar todas as regras do Iptables na porta 80

2

Eu queria saber se existe um comando para listar / encontrar todas as regras do iptables na porta 80 (ou qualquer outra porta)? Por exemplo, algo assim:

iptables --list | grep port 80
    
por Dennis 05.10.2018 / 03:06

2 respostas

0

 iptables --list|grep "spt:\|dpt:\|dports\|sports"

spt: e dpt cobrem regras de porta individuais

esportes e dports cobrem o comando multiport

Agora, todas as regras que mencionam portas devem ser listadas.

 iptables --list|grep "spt:\|dpt:\|dports\|sports"|grep http

Uma vez que você faz isso, você percebe que o iptables usa o nome da porta, então você tem que grep para http ao invés de 80.

Se você quiser ver os números de porta reais, faça o seguinte:

 iptables-save|grep "spt:\|dpt:\|dports\|sports"

A saída será significativamente diferente, então isso pode ou não funcionar para você.

 iptables-save|grep "spt:\|dpt:\|dports\|sports"|grep 80
    
por 05.10.2018 / 05:32
0

Uma coisa a lembrar é que você está olhando para 80 porque quer tráfego na web. Eu não sei exatamente o que você está fazendo, mas apenas no caso isso ajuda, lembre-se 80 é primário http, mas 8080 também é configurado em alguns servidores da web como um secundário, bem como 443 é seguro protocolo web (HTTPS via SSL ).

Isso não deveria ser uma resposta, apenas um comentário sobre a primeira resposta, mas eu não tenho pontos de reputação suficientes para postar comentários, então ... eu ainda espero que isso seja útil

    
por 05.10.2018 / 05:59